Unlocking Success: Choosing a perfect Salesforce Edition for Your Needs
Navigating the vast landscape of Salesforce editions can feel overwhelming. Every business has unique requirements, and selecting the correct edition is crucial for success. To make the best fit, evaluate your current processes and future objectives. Are you a growing enterprise needing basic functionality? Or a enterprise requiring complex solutions? Defining your unique needs will empower you in choosing the Salesforce edition that optimizes your productivity and drives growth.
- Suppose you're a small business, Salesforce Essentials might be the perfect solution. It offers essential features for handling your contacts, sales, and service.
- Conversely, if you're a larger enterprise with complex needs, Salesforce Enterprise might be more suitable. This edition provides advanced features for configuration, integration, and analytics.
Be aware that this is just a broad guideline. The best Salesforce edition for your business will depend on your unique circumstances. Don't hesitate to speak with a Salesforce expert to receive personalized suggestions.
Salesforce License Audit Essentials: Ensuring Compliance and Efficiency
Conducting regular Salesforce license audits is essential for ensuring your organization remains adherent with Salesforce's terms of service and maximizing your investment. A thorough audit reveals any potential licensing discrepancies and helps you optimize your license allocation for enhanced performance.
- Prior to a Salesforce license audit, it's important to assess your current usage patterns and pinpoint any areas where licenses are not utilized.
- Leveraging reporting tools within Salesforce can provide valuable information to guide your audit process. These reports can illustrate user activity, license assignments, and potential opportunities for optimization.
- Once the audit, execute corrective actions to adjust your licenses with your actual needs. This may involve reassigning licenses or exploring alternative licensing options.

Refine Your Salesforce Environment: A Comprehensive Audit Approach
A well-maintained Salesforce environment drives success for any business. To ensure peak performance and leverage the full potential of your platform, a thorough audit should be undertaken. This review will allow you to identify areas for improvement, eliminate redundancies, and adopt best practices.
By taking a strategic approach to auditing your Salesforce environment, you can gain valuable insights.
A comprehensive audit should cover the following key areas:
* Setup: Evaluate existing settings and configurations to identify areas for optimization.
* Workflows: Analyze your automated workflows to verify they are efficient, effective, and aligned with business requirements.
* Data Management: Assess data quality, integrity, and organization to eliminate redundancy and ensure accuracy.
* User Adoption: Evaluate user adoption rates and provide targeted training to maximize platform utilization.
Adopting the recommendations derived from your audit will enhance your Salesforce environment, accelerating productivity, enhancing collaboration, and ultimately contributing to your overall business success.
